What Are Sector ETFs and Why They Matter

A sector ETF is a basket of stocks from one industry or economic sector. Instead of buying Microsoft, Apple, and Nvidia individually, you buy XLK (Technology Select Sector SPDR) and own all 65 tech stocks in the S&P 500 in a single trade.

This matters because sectors are the building blocks of the market. The S&P 500 isn't a random collection—it's organized into 11 official sectors defined by GICS (Global Industry Classification Standard). Each sector responds differently to economic cycles, interest rates, and investor sentiment.

Consider 2022: the Technology sector (represented by XLK) fell 29.9%, while the Energy sector (XLE) rose 53.6% as oil prices surged. A portfolio invested equally in both would have weathered the downturn far better than a tech-heavy portfolio.

The 11 Sectors: Characteristics and Major ETFs

The stock market is divided into 11 official sectors. Each has distinct performance drivers, dividend yields, and risk profiles.

Sector Key ETF (SPDR) Index Weight Dividend Yield Volatility Profile
Technology XLK 28.8% 0.6% High
Healthcare XLV 12.5% 1.4% Medium
Financials XLF 12.3% 2.8% Medium-High
Industrials XLI 8.2% 1.9% Medium
Consumer Discretionary XLY 9.7% 0.4% High
Consumer Staples XLP 6.0% 2.6% Low
Energy XLE 3.8% 3.1% High
Utilities XLU 2.7% 3.2% Low
Real Estate (REITs) XLRE 2.8% 3.4% Medium-High
Materials XLB 2.1% 2.0% High
Communication Services XLC 8.3% 1.2% High

Data as of December 2024. Index weights and dividend yields subject to change.

Technology Sector (XLK)

Technology includes software, semiconductors, hardware, and IT services. It's the largest sector at 28.8% of the S&P 500, dominated by mega-cap names like Microsoft, Apple, Nvidia, and Meta.

XLK characteristics: Low dividend yield (0.6%), high growth expectations, and significant volatility. When interest rates rise (making future earnings worth less), tech stocks typically fall. XLK dropped 37.2% in 2022 as the Fed raised rates from 0% to 4.25%, but recovered 42% in 2023 as the rate-hiking cycle ended.

Healthcare Sector (XLV)

Healthcare covers pharmaceuticals, medical devices, insurance, and biotech. It's relatively recession-resistant because people buy medicine and seek healthcare regardless of economic conditions.

XLV characteristics: Moderate dividend yield (1.4%), defensive positioning, and regulatory risk (FDA approvals, patent expirations). XLV outperformed in 2022 (down only 5.6%) while XLK fell 29.9%, demonstrating its safe-haven role during volatility.

Financials Sector (XLF)

Financials include banks, insurance, and investment management. This sector is highly sensitive to interest rates—banks earn more when rates are higher because they charge borrowers more.

XLF characteristics: Elevated dividend yield (2.8%), cyclical exposure, and leverage risk. When the Fed raised rates in 2022, XLF only fell 16.8% (vs. XLK's 29.9%) because higher rates benefited bank margins. But banking crises (like SVB in March 2023) can spike volatility.

Consumer Discretionary vs. Consumer Staples (XLY vs. XLP)

Consumer Discretionary includes retail, restaurants, and luxury goods—things people buy when confident. Consumer Staples includes groceries, household products, and toiletries—things people buy regardless of economic conditions.

XLY is growth-oriented (low dividend, high volatility). XLP is defensive (high dividend, low volatility). During recessions, XLP typically outperforms because demand for staples is inelastic. During expansions, XLY outperforms because discretionary spending surges.

Energy Sector (XLE)

Energy includes oil, gas, and renewable companies. This sector moves with crude oil prices, which are driven by global supply disruptions, geopolitical events, and recession fears.

XLE characteristics: High dividend yield (3.1%), high volatility, and strong upside when oil prices spike. XLE surged 53.6% in 2022 when Russia invaded Ukraine and oil prices hit $130/barrel. But it's also vulnerable to demand shocks—XLE fell 37.8% in 2020 when COVID lockdowns crashed oil prices to $20/barrel.

Utilities and REITs (XLU, XLRE)

Utilities provide electricity, water, and gas with stable cash flows. Real Estate includes apartment buildings, office spaces, and shopping centers. Both have high dividend yields (3.2% and 3.4%) and low volatility, functioning as bond-like investments.

These sectors are ideal for income-focused investors willing to accept lower growth. However, rising interest rates hurt both—higher yields on bonds make their fixed dividends less attractive, so prices fall. XLU and XLRE both dropped significantly in 2022 as the Fed raised rates.

How Sector ETFs Work: The Mechanics

Passive vs. Actively Managed Sector ETFs

Most sector ETFs are passive, meaning they simply hold every stock in a sector weighted by market capitalization. XLK holds all 65 technology stocks in the S&P 500 in the same proportions they represent in the index.

Actively managed alternatives like ARKK (Ark Innovation) or PUHSX (PIMCO Sector Rotation Fund) let managers pick and weight stocks differently. The trade-off: active funds charge higher fees (0.75% to 1.00% annually) but theoretically add value through stock selection.

Historically, passive sector ETFs have beaten 70% of active funds over 15-year periods, as documented by SPDR analysis of GICS sector data. Lower fees compound significantly over time.

Expense Ratios: What You Actually Pay

The SPDR sector ETFs (XLK, XLV, XLF, etc.) charge 0.03% to 0.10% annually. On a $10,000 investment, that's $3 to $10 per year. Vanguard sector ETFs (VGT for tech, VHT for healthcare) charge similar rates.

Compare this to actively managed sector mutual funds, which average 0.50% to 1.00% per year. On the same $10,000, you'd pay $50 to $100. Over 20 years, that difference compounds to thousands in lost returns due to fees alone.

Tracking Error and Rebalancing

ETFs must regularly add and remove stocks as companies enter/exit a sector. When a stock is added to the S&P 500, XLK must buy it. When a company is deleted (bankruptcy, merger), XLK must sell it. This rebalancing creates small performance deviations from the official index, called tracking error.

For sector ETFs, annual tracking error is typically 0.01% to 0.05%—negligible. The bigger issue is timing: if XLK buys a stock right before it falls, it underperforms the index slightly. But over years, tracking error averages out.

Sector Rotation: Tactical Trading with ETFs

Sector rotation is the practice of shifting money between sectors based on economic conditions and market cycles. The theory: sectors perform in predictable patterns tied to economic cycles.

The Classic Economic Cycle Model

According to S&P Dow Jones Indices research, different sectors lead at different stages:

  • Early Expansion: Financials (XLF) and Materials (XLB) outperform as credit loosens and commodity prices rise
  • Late Expansion: Consumer Discretionary (XLY) and Technology (XLK) outperform as consumers spend freely and companies invest in growth
  • Early Contraction: Utilities (XLU), Consumer Staples (XLP), and Healthcare (XLV) outperform as investors seek safety
  • Late Contraction: Energy (XLE) and Materials (XLB) may spike as commodities bottom-out and cheap valuations attract buyers

Real Example: 2020-2024 Sector Performance

Here's how this played out in practice:

  • March-June 2020 (Expansion): Fed cut rates to zero, bought bonds. Financials (XLF) and Materials (XLB) surged 40-50% as investors expected recovery.
  • 2021 (Late Expansion): Tech (XLK) soared 33%, Consumer Discretionary (XLY) up 23% as stimulus fueled spending and innovation bets.
  • 2022 (Contraction): Fed raised rates 400 basis points. Utilities (XLU) fell only 8%, Consumer Staples (XLP) fell 6%, while Tech (XLK) crashed 29.9%.
  • 2023 (Recovery): Soft landing narrative emerged. Tech (XLK) rebounded 42%, outperforming defensive sectors.
  • 2024 (Mixed): AI enthusiasm boosted Tech, but interest rates remained elevated, supporting Financials and Energy.

A study by Morningstar showed that sector rotation strategies outperformed equal-weight S&P 500 returns in 9 of the past 15 years. However, getting the timing right consistently is extraordinarily difficult—most tactical traders underperform buy-and-hold due to trading costs and emotional decisions.

How to Implement Sector Rotation

If you want to use sector ETFs tactically, here's a disciplined approach:

  1. Start with a core portfolio of 60-70% broad index funds (VTI, VOO) or a balanced allocation (60/40 stocks/bonds)
  2. Allocate 20-30% to sector tilts based on your economic outlook
  3. Use fundamental signals like yield curves, Fed policy, unemployment, PMI, and earnings growth to guide decisions—not hunches
  4. Rebalance quarterly or semi-annually, not daily. Frequent trading kills returns through costs and taxes
  5. Set stop-losses for losing bets. If you buy XLE expecting oil to rise but crude falls 15%, sell and redeploy

Expense Ratios, Spreads, and Costs

Beyond the annual expense ratio, you'll encounter trading costs and spreads.

Bid-Ask Spreads

When you buy XLK, you pay the "ask" price; when you sell, you receive the "bid" price. The difference is the bid-ask spread. For heavily traded sector ETFs like XLK, XLV, and XLF, spreads average $0.01 to $0.02 per share—negligible on a $150+ ETF.

But for smaller sector ETFs or leveraged versions (like 3x Technology ETFs), spreads can widen to $0.10 or more, costing real money on small positions.

Tax Efficiency

ETFs are more tax-efficient than mutual funds because they can distribute losses in ways that offset capital gains. This "tax-loss harvesting" advantage is meaningful in taxable accounts over decades.

Example: You buy $10,000 of XLK at $150. It falls to $120. You sell for a $3,000 loss (harvesting the loss for tax purposes), then immediately buy a similar tech ETF like VGT. You've offset $3,000 of gains elsewhere without reducing your exposure.

Building a Diversified Portfolio with Sector ETFs

The Core-Satellite Approach

Most investors shouldn't concentrate in sector bets. Instead, use the "core-satellite" framework:

  • Core (70-80%): Broad total market ETFs (VTI) or S&P 500 (VOO) already give you automatic sector diversification
  • Satellites (20-30%): Overweight or underweight specific sectors using individual sector ETFs based on your views

Example allocation for someone bullish on healthcare/defensive sectors and bearish on tech:

  • $50,000 (50%) in VTI (total market—75% domestic stocks)
  • $15,000 (15%) in XLV (Healthcare overweight)
  • $10,000 (10%) in XLP (Consumer Staples overweight)
  • $10,000 (10%) in XLU (Utilities overweight)
  • $10,000 (10%) in XLF (Financials overweight)
  • $5,000 (5%) in BND (Bonds for safety)

This portfolio tilts defensive without abandoning tech exposure entirely (VTI still holds 30% tech).

Sector Allocation as a Percentage of S&P 500

Before overweighting a sector, understand its current index weight. Tech is 28.8% of the S&P 500 already. If you want to "overweight" tech to 35%, you're making a bold bet that justifies additional risk.

For most investors, maintaining index weights (buying sector ETFs in proportion to their S&P 500 weight) through a single broad fund (VOO) is simpler and often performs better.

Common Mistakes and Pitfalls

Mistake #1: Chasing Recent Performance

The most dangerous trap is buying sector ETFs that have just soared. Tech (XLK) was up 42% in 2023, so investors piled in. Then in early 2024, as AI hype cooled, tech underperformed.

How to avoid this: Buy sectors trading at low valuations relative to earnings, not sectors with the best recent returns. Use price-to-earnings, price-to-sales, or dividend yield as guides.

Mistake #2: Sector Concentration Without Economic Understanding

Buying XLE (Energy) because "oil is cheap" without understanding geopolitical supply shocks, OPEC production decisions, or recession risks is gambling, not investing.

How to avoid this: Before buying a sector ETF, write down three specific reasons why you think it will outperform over your time horizon (e.g., "Healthcare because aging populations will demand more medical services"). If you can't articulate a thesis, don't buy it.

Mistake #3: Using Leveraged Sector ETFs for Long-Term Holds

Leveraged sector ETFs (like TECL, a 3x Technology ETF) amplify daily movements. TECL falls 3% on days XLK falls 1%. But leveraged ETFs experience "decay" over time—volatility compounds against you. Holding TECL for years almost guarantees underperformance versus XLK, even if XLK outperforms overall.

How to avoid this: Reserve leveraged ETFs for tactical, short-term trades only (days to weeks). Hold unleveraged sector ETFs for long-term positions.

Mistake #4: Ignoring Correlation and Concentration

Sector ETFs move together more than you might think. During 2022's bear market, all 11 sectors fell, with only Energy outperforming. "Diversifying" across XLK, XLV, XLF, and XLI didn't protect you much—they all declined 5-30%.

How to avoid this: Add uncorrelated assets (bonds, gold, international stocks) to reduce systematic risk. Diversify across assets, not just sectors.

Mistake #5: Forgetting About Rebalancing

If you allocate 20% to XLK and 10% to XLE, but tech soars 50% and energy falls 20%, XLK becomes 30% of your portfolio. You're now overexposed to your original assumption. Rebalancing forces you to sell XLK (high) and buy XLE (low), locking in gains and buying dips.

How to avoid this: Set a rebalancing schedule—quarterly or semi-annually. When any position drifts more than 5% from your target allocation, rebalance back.

Mistake #6: Overthinking Sector Timing

Even professional asset allocators struggle to time sector rotations consistently. Research by Vanguard and Dimensional found that tactical sector allocation underperformed strategic (set-and-hold) allocation 70% of the time after accounting for fees and trading costs.

How to avoid this: Use sector ETFs opportunistically—buying dips during downturns, trimming excesses during bubbles—rather than attempting frequent rotations based on macroeconomic predictions.

Frequently Asked Questions About Sector ETFs

Q: Should I own both a broad index fund (VOO) and sector ETFs?

VOO (S&P 500) is already diversified across all 11 sectors. Buying VOO + individual sector ETFs creates redundancy and overconcentration in overweighted sectors. Better approach: own VOO as your core (80-90%) and add sector ETFs only if you have a specific tactical view (e.g., "Financials will outperform because rates are rising").

Q: What's the difference between XLK and VGT (Vanguard Technology)?

XLK is SPDR-managed and includes all 65 S&P 500 tech stocks. VGT is Vanguard-managed and includes 369 large-cap tech stocks (broader universe beyond the S&P 500, including mid-caps). Both charge 0.10% annually. VGT has slightly lower concentration risk but higher volatility. For most investors, XLK and VGT perform nearly identically—choose based on your brokerage's commission structure.

Q: Can I use sector ETFs in a retirement account like a 401(k) or IRA?

Yes. If your 401(k) or IRA offers mutual funds (including ETF equivalents), you can hold sector funds. Most brokers offer sector ETF access in IRAs. Tax-loss harvesting (selling losers to offset gains) is irrelevant in tax-deferred accounts, but sector rotation strategies still work. Expense ratios and long-term returns matter more in retirement accounts because gains compound tax-free for decades.

Q: Are dividend-focused sector ETFs like SDVY (S&P 500 Dividend Aristocrats) better than broad sector ETFs?

No. SDVY screens for companies that increased dividends for 25+ consecutive years, reducing the universe significantly and introducing "dividend quality" bias. Backtests show SDVY slightly outperformed the S&P 500 before fees, but underperformed after fees (0.39% ER). For dividend income, XLP (Consumer Staples) and XLU (Utilities) are simpler—they're already high-dividend sectors within their broad sector ETF structures.

Q: How do I know when to buy or sell a sector ETF?

Use a combination of valuation (P/E ratio relative to historical average), economic signals (Fed policy, yield curve, unemployment), and technical levels (resistance/support). For example: buy XLE when crude oil falls 30% from highs (valuations cheap) + Fed has stopped raising rates (economic signal supports energy). Sell XLK when P/E reaches 25x earnings + Fed signals more rate hikes (valuations rich + headwind). Avoid buying based purely on recent performance or "hot tips."

Q: What's the difference between XLK and QQQ (Nasdaq-100)?

XLK is S&P 500 tech only (65 stocks, 28.8% of S&P 500). QQQ is all 100 largest Nasdaq stocks, heavily weighted to tech (~40%) but also including healthcare, energy, and other sectors. QQQ is more concentrated than XLK (top 10 stocks are 45% of QQQ vs. 35% of XLK). QQQ outperformed XLK in 2023 but also underperformed more in 2022. For tech exposure, XLK is more balanced; for aggressive growth, QQQ is more leveraged to mega-cap tech giants.
